Saté Mixed Grill With Spicy Peanut Sauce
- 8 ounces skinned and boned chicken breasts
- 8 ounces lean pork loin
- 8 ounces lean beef sirloin
- 8 ounces unpeeled medium-size fresh shrimp
- 1/3 cup lite soy sauce
- 1/3 cup fresh lime juice
- 1 tablespoon honey
- 4 garlic cloves, minced
- 2 teaspoons ground coriander
- 2 teaspoons ground turmeric
- 40 (6-inch) wooden skewers
- Cut chicken and pork into 3- x 1/2- inch strips. Cut beef sirloin into thin long strips. Peel shrimp, and devein, if desired. Place chicken, pork, beef, and shrimp in separate bowls.
- Whisk together soy sauce and next 5 ingredients. Drizzle evenly over bowls of meat and shrimp; toss to coat. Cover and chill 30 minutes. Soak skewers in cold water to prevent burning.
- Thread chicken, pork, beef, and shrimp evenly onto skewers (10 skewers of each ingredient).
- Grill, covered with grill lid, over medium-high heat (350u0b0 to 400u0b0) 1 to 3 minutes on each side.
- Arrange skewers on a platter, and serve with Spicy Peanut Sauce.
